Determination of the structure of agarose gels by gel chromatography

Biochimica et Biophysica Acta (BBA) - General Subjects, 1967
Abstract Well-characterized fractions of the synthetic polysaccharide Ficoll have been chromatographed on columns of pearl-condensed agarose gels of concentrations between 2 and 8%. The results agree with the theory that the Ficoll is sterically excluded from the gel, which is made up of a random three-dimensional network of long fibers.
